I have an IC-745 that is not working in CW. When I key it, and the vox delay is for semi break in, the transmitter sends a continuous carrier, does not produce the cw characters. The rig does not have the internal Curtiss keyer, I am keying it with a manual morse key. I checked all the components in the keying circuit and they are OK. Anybody has had any similar experience and could give me a hint?
